Neste curso, você aprenderá a instalar o Jenkins em uma máquina Linux usando Docker e dominará os fundamentos de integração contínua e implantação contínua (CI/CD) usando Jenkins. Desde a exploração da interface até a criação de pipelines e o gerenciamento de segurança, este curso abrangente cobre tudo o que você precisa para começar com o Jenkins.
🎯 Tarefas
Neste curso, você aprenderá:
- Como instalar o Jenkins em uma máquina Linux usando Docker
- Como navegar e explorar a interface do Jenkins
- Como configurar e gerenciar projetos freestyle básicos
- Como integrar o Jenkins com o Git para controle de versão
- Como parametrizar builds e usar scripts shell/batch
- Como criar e gerenciar pipelines do Jenkins com Jenkinsfiles
- Como instalar, atualizar e configurar plugins do Jenkins
- Como implementar segurança básica e gerenciamento de usuários no Jenkins
🏆 Conquistas
Após concluir este curso, você será capaz de:
- Navegar pelo dashboard do Jenkins e criar seus primeiros projetos
- Configurar projetos freestyle com etapas de build, gatilhos e ações pós-build
- Integrar o Jenkins com repositórios Git para builds automatizados de controle de versão
- Criar builds parametrizados e usar scripts para processos de build complexos
- Construir e gerenciar pipelines de CI/CD usando Jenkinsfiles declarativos
- Gerenciar plugins do Jenkins e configurá-los para suas necessidades específicas
- Implementar medidas de segurança e gerenciar contas de usuários com permissões adequadas
- Automatizar seus processos de desenvolvimento e implantação de software usando Jenkins


